Heavy rainfall likely in some areas of four provinces



KATHMANDU: The monsoon winds are currently affecting the entire country, with the low-pressure line situated south of its usual position, according to the Department of Hydrology and Meteorology.

As a result, the weather will be partly to generally cloudy throughout the country.

Light to moderate rainfall is already occurring in isolated areas of the Koshi and Gandaki provinces.

The Meteorological Forecasting Division has stated that this afternoon, the weather will remain partly to generally cloudy nationwide.

Light to moderate rain with thunder and lightning is expected in a few areas across the Koshi, Bagmati, Gandaki, Lumbini, Karnali, and Sudurpaschim provinces.

Heavy rainfall is anticipated in one or two locations within the Gandaki, Lumbini, and Karnali provinces.

Tonight, the weather will continue to be partly to generally cloudy across the country, with chances of light to moderate rain accompanied by thunder and lightning in some areas of Gandaki, Lumbini, and Sudurpaschim provinces.

Heavy rainfall is also expected in one or two locations in Koshi, Gandaki, Lumbini, and Sudurpaschim provinces.

Over the next 24 hours, light to moderate rain with thunder and lightning is likely in several areas of Koshi, Bagmati, Gandaki, Lumbini, Karnali, and Sudurpaschim provinces.

The Department has issued a warning for the general public to remain alert due to the expected heavy rainfall in these provinces.
